    Try eating cooked beans/lentils ( sundal in tamil ) as a snack. They are supposed to be good for diabetics too since they are rich in fiber and protein. Make a variety of them and you will not be bored too. You will feel full also.
    Hummus dip with veggies can be a good snack. If you crave for fried foods, try making a healthier version at home ( bake it or grill it ).

    Try to think why it is that you are always snacking. If you're snacking in response to hunger, it shouldn't be cause for alarm. If you're snacking from boredom, or just to occupy yourself, do something else like walking, jogging or cleaning up (or anything else to keep yourself occupied).

    Here's something that I follow: If I want to eat something, I rate how hungry I am from 1-10 with 10 being famished. If I rate my hunger over 5 or 6, I eat something, the quantity and food type depending on how hungry I am, otherwise I wait for an hour or two. It works for me to stop snacking endlessly.

    Often, I also find that I'm just thirsty when I feel like I want to eat something. So I first drink a glass or two of water before eating something and that mostly helps keep the snacking in check.
